Movie theaters use lights to illuminate the theater and ensure that viewers can see the film they are watching. Lights are usually placed in strategic locations around the theater and can be used to set a mood or provide extra illumination when needed. These lights, whether they are dimmable, colored, or otherwise, all have one thing in common—they are all known as Movie Theater Lights.
Movie theater lights come in a variety of shapes and sizes. Depending on the size of the theater, there may be a variety of different fixtures used for lighting.
These fixtures may include spotlights, downlights, wall washers, and more. Each type of light is used to achieve different effects and provide different levels of illumination.
The most common type of movie theater light is the spotlight. These lights are often placed at the front of the theater and aimed at the screen. Spotlights are designed to create an even level of illumination across a large area and are ideal for providing an evenly lit viewing experience.
Downlights also play an important role in movie theaters by providing additional illumination when needed. Downlights are usually placed at various points throughout a theater and aim downward toward seating areas or other areas where extra light is needed. Wall washers can also be used to provide additional lighting in specific areas such as lobbies or aisleways.
Colored lighting can also be used to set a particular mood or ambiance within a movie theater. Color-changing lighting systems allow for dynamic changes in light color throughout the course of a film which can help create an immersive experience for viewers.

Floor lights in a movie theater can be an important part of the overall experience for patrons. Not only do they provide a safe and enjoyable environment for customers to enjoy their movie, but they can also add to the atmosphere and ambience of the theater. Floor lights are typically called footlights, step lights, or aisle lights depending on where they are located.
